How much does a Mechanical Engineer III make in Voca, TX? The average Mechanical Engineer III salary in Voca, TX is $103,364 as of August 27, 2024, but the range typically falls between $94,171 and $113,319.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on many important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ession. Percentile | Salary | Location | Last Updated |
10th Percentile Mechanical Engineer III Salary | $85,801 | Voca,TX | August 27, 2024 |
25th Percentile Mechanical Engineer III Salary | $94,171 | Voca,TX | August 27, 2024 |
50th Percentile Mechanical Engineer III Salary | $103,364 | Voca,TX | August 27, 2024 |
75th Percentile Mechanical Engineer III Salary | $113,319 | Voca,TX | August 27, 2024 |
90th Percentile Mechanical Engineer III Salary | $122,383 | Voca,TX | August 27, 2024 |

Mechanical Engineer III designs, analyzes, and maintains mechanical components and systems to meet specified requirements and standards. Utilizes technical instruments to develop specifications for new parts, modifications, or prototypes. Being a Mechanical Engineer III identifies appropriate materials and processes to ensure the quality, performance, and manufacturability of products. Utilizes CAD software and other design and modeling tools to plan, develop, and improve mechanical parts or components and communicate conceptual designs and specifications to stakeholders. Additionally, Mechanical Engineer III conducts prototype testing to evaluate the performance, reliability, and safety of mechanical systems and collects and analyzes data for improvements. Analyzes and troubleshoots mechanical issues or failures to identify root causes and develop solutions. Requires a bachelor's degree in mechanical engineering. Typically reports to a manager. The Mechanical Engineer III work is generally independent and collaborative in nature. Contributes to moderately complex aspects of a project. To be a Mechanical Engineer III typically requires 4-7 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)... View full job description

A career path is a sequence of jobs that leads to your short- and long-term career goals. Some follow a linear career path within one field, while others change fields periodically to achieve career or personal goals.
For Mechanical Engineer III, the first career path typically starts with a Mechanical Product Engineer IV position, and then progresses to Mechanical Product Engineer V.
Additionally, the second career path typically starts with a Mechanical Engineer IV position, and then progresses to Mechanical Engineer V.

Mechanical Engineer III salary varies from city to city. Compared with national average salary of Mechanical Engineer III, the highest Mechanical Engineer III salary is in San Francisco, CA, where the Mechanical Engineer III salary is 25.0% above. The lowest Mechanical Engineer III salary is in Miami, FL, where the Mechanical Engineer III salary is 3.5% lower than national average salary.
